VIOLET GWENDOLYN SMITH (GOULD) Peacefully, on Saturday, January 4, 2003, at the Grace Hospital, Violet passed away at the age of 71. She was born on November 20, 1931, in Fairlight, SK. She was predeceased by her mother Mary Gould; father Archibald Gould; brothers, Bob, Albert and Howard; sisters, Helen and Olive. Violet is survived by her children, Larry Wingert (Margurite) of British Columbia, Connie Brown (Larry) of Stony Mountain, Terry Davies (Lance) of British Columbia, Robert Smith (Liza) of Winnipeg and Jim Smith (Kathy) of Alberta; grandchildren, Carla, Dwight, Katie, Sarah, Matthew and Hannah; sisters, Peggy, Alma, Martha and Doris; brothers, Donald, Clarence and George; and many nieces and nephews. For many years Mom operated a daycare in her home for special needs children. She cared for these children like they were her own. She helped these children overcome many difficult problems until she retired at age 65. In her last few years she went to live at Calvary Place Personal Care Home, where everyone loved her. She loved to play jokes and be very mischievous with the staff. She will be missed and cherished by many, many people.
